Event Overview

Financial services Web site owners continue to focus on improving trust models to prevent an erosion of consumer trust because of malicious Web sites and phishing attacks. Join this webcast to learn how Windows Internet Explorer 7 supports Extended Validation (EV) Secure Socket Layer (SSL) certificates. These certificates promote strong user identification for Web sites, which helps boost consumer trust of conducting online transactions on financial services Web sites. We discuss how financial services Web site owners can implement EV SSL, and we share best practices for implementing SSL-protected Web sites.

Presenter: Markellos Diorinos, Product Manager, Microsoft Corporation
